Benjamin Zander
Benjamin Zander, British conductor, educator.
Background
Zander, Benjamin was born on March 9, 1939 in London.
Education
-
Diploma, State Conservatory, Cologne, 1960; Bachelor, London University, 1964; Studied cello with, Gaspar Cassadó.
Career
-
Professor chamber music, performance and analysis New England Conservatory of Music, Boston, since 1967, conductor Youth Philharmonic Orchestra, since 1972. Museum director, conductor Boston Philharmonic Orchestra, since 1979. Artistic director Walnut Hill High School for the Performing Arts.
